Santa Clara Beach Volleyball Crushes Hawaii Pacific 5-0
Santa Clara University鈥檚 beach volleyball team achieved a commanding 5-0 victory against Hawaii Pacific in their first match of the weekend in Honolulu. The Broncos demonstrated dominance by winning all five pairs in straight sets, stifling the Sharks in six out of ten sets played. Key players included Kawena Chillingworth and Reilly Rose Gilliland, who won their match with a staggering score of 21-7, 21-3.
